package com.suarte.webapp.listener;
import junit.framework.TestCase;
import org.appfuse.Constants;
import org.springframework.mock.web.MockServletContext;
import org.springframework.web.context.ContextLoader;
import org.springframework.web.context.WebApplicationContext;
import org.springframework.web.context.ContextLoaderListener;
import javax.servlet.ServletContextEvent;
import javax.servlet.ServletContextListener;
import java.util.Map;
/**
* This class tests the StartupListener class to verify that variables are
* placed into the servlet context.
*
* @author <a href="mailto:matt@raibledesigns.com">Matt Raible</a>
*/
public class StartupListenerTest extends TestCase {
private MockServletContext sc = null;
private ServletContextListener listener = null;
private ContextLoaderListener springListener = null;
protected void setUp() throws Exception {
super.setUp();
sc = new MockServletContext("");
sc.addInitParameter(Constants.CSS_THEME, "simplicity");
// initialize Spring
sc.addInitParameter(ContextLoader.CONFIG_LOCATION_PARAM,
"classpath:/applicationContext-dao.xml, " +
"classpath:/applicationContext-service.xml, " +
"classpath:/applicationContext-resources.xml");
springListener = new ContextLoaderListener();
springListener.contextInitialized(new ServletContextEvent(sc));
listener = new StartupListener();
}
protected void tearDown() throws Exception {
super.tearDown();
springListener = null;
listener = null;
sc = null;
}
public void testContextInitialized() {
listener.contextInitialized(new ServletContextEvent(sc));
assertTrue(sc.getAttribute(Constants.CONFIG) != null);
Map config = (Map) sc.getAttribute(Constants.CONFIG);
assertEquals(config.get(Constants.CSS_THEME), "simplicity");
assertTrue(sc.getAttribute(WebApplicationContext
.ROOT_WEB_APPLICATION_CONTEXT_ATTRIBUTE) != null);
assertTrue(sc.getAttribute(Constants.AVAILABLE_ROLES) != null);
}
}
